systemdlete2 | how can I get a newer kernel for ascii? I have 4.9.0-9, and I think, based on Internet posts addressing my issue, I need about 4.10 | 06:35 |
golinux | systemdlete2: https://pkginfo.devuan.org/cgi-bin/d1pkgweb-query?search=linux-image-4.10&release=any | 06:43 |

systemdlete | I solved it by just "apt -t ascii-backports linux-image-whatever-the-heck..." | 13:33 |
systemdlete | it installed the 4.19 kernel and it really DOES make my laptop settle down. It is much more stable now. I can log out of xfce 10x, or it seems, and no longer hangs. But stay tuned; I've seen these issues return | 13:34 |
